Brussels restaurant in the dark to address the energy crisis

In the center of Brussels, a group of restaurateurs showed what the future of the hospitality industry could look like. No electricity or gas is used in the Brasserie Surrealiste. The food was served and cooked by Racines employees, without ovens, stoves, hobs, coffee machines and light bulbs. Through the campaign, the restaurant owners want to raise awareness of the rapidly rising energy prices. Watch the full report in the video above.
